Lecture 8 love and sexuality, nov 17th, 2015. Love: what is dating, developmental course of love, sternberg"s theory of love. Together: dating, going out, hanging out, seeing each other, one-night stand, cuffing, hooking up, calling, courting, engagement. Friends with benefits: love developmental course of love. Learning: becoming more skilled at dating interactions. Impressing others according to how often and whom one dates. Companionship: sharing pleasurable activities with another person. Intimacy: establishing a close emotional relationship with another person. Courtship: seeking someone to have as a steady partner. What do girls look for: emphasize interpersonal qualities such as support and intimacy. What do boys look for: middle adolescence boys focus on physical attractiveness, by late adolescence, more similar to girls, both boys and girls focus on intimacy, communication, commitment, and passion. From a few weeks or months; few last a year or longer: gets longer as they get older.
